  • Jun 6, 1942
    Webb Pierce marries Betty Jane Lewis, while stationed at Camp Polk, Louisiana, with the U.S. Army
    Jun 14, 1942
    Rose Maddox marries her first husband, E.B. Hale, in Reno, Nevada
    Aug 10, 1942
    Bob Wills takes wife #5 in marriage #6 at Clovis, New Mexico, saying "I do" to the former Betty Anderson
    Sep 12, 1942
    John Stoneman, of The Stoneman Family, marries Deeta Yeary
    Sep 18, 1942
    Bombardier instructor Tennessee Ernie Ford marries his first wife, Betty Heminger
    Oct 12, 1942
    Jazz trumpeter Louis Armstrong marries his fourth wife, Lucille Wilson. A dozen years prior, he took part in the recording session for Jimmie Rodgers' "Blue Yodel No. 9 (Standin' On The Corner)"
    Jun 28, 1943
    Donna King, of the pop group The King Sisters, marries record executive Jim Conkling. Four years later, the Sisters pull in a country hit with "Divorce Me C.O.D."
    Jul 12, 1943
    Sergeant Lou Busch, employed as an arranger at the Santa Ana Army Air Base, marries actress Janet Blair in Lake Arrowhead, California. He adopts a stage name, Joe "Fingers" Carr, and later shares billing with Tennessee Ernie Ford on a country hit
    Jul 18, 1943
    The Weavers' Pete Seeger marries Toshi Ohta
    Sep 24, 1943
    Emmett Miller marries Bernice Calhoun in Macon, Georgia. The black-faced performer influenced Jimmie Rodgers and made the first recording of "Lovesick Blues," later associated with Hank Williams
